Transaction 16083c93af35d1735b6e0059625b807b673b94be1ece04fc7bd670b05e71c6cf
1 Input
2 Outputs
- 16083c93af35d1735b6e0059625b807b673b94be1ece04fc7bd670b05e71c6cf:0
- 16083c93af35d1735b6e0059625b807b673b94be1ece04fc7bd670b05e71c6cf:1
value 21647
address 19fsrducp15pKFeq9hK4DbGhsVWWb9JjpW
value 4336240
address 3FeHqVCSVN1X5wBeKUAEqj5BMrUw1r6Xzm